Provide branch speculation information captured via AMD Last Branch Record Extension Version 2 (LbrExtV2) by setting the speculation info in branch records. The info is based on the "valid" and "spec" bits in the Branch To registers.
Suggested-by: Stephane Eranian <eranian@google.com> Signed-off-by: Sandipan Das <sandipan.das@amd.com> --- arch/x86/events/amd/lbr.c | 35 ++++++++++++++++++++++++++++++++--- 1 file changed, 32 insertions(+), 3 deletions(-)
diff --git a/arch/x86/events/amd/lbr.c b/arch/x86/events/amd/lbr.c index 5fa985cd44cb..3fd316b6adda 100644 --- a/arch/x86/events/amd/lbr.c +++ b/arch/x86/events/amd/lbr.c @@ -146,12 +146,19 @@ static void amd_pmu_lbr_filter(void) } } +static const int lbr_spec_map[PERF_BR_SPEC_MAX] = { + PERF_BR_SPEC_NA, + PERF_BR_SPEC_WRONG_PATH, + PERF_BR_NON_SPEC_CORRECT_PATH, + PERF_BR_SPEC_CORRECT_PATH, +}; + void amd_pmu_lbr_read(void) { struct cpu_hw_events *cpuc = this_cpu_ptr(&cpu_hw_events); struct perf_branch_entry *br = cpuc->lbr_entries; struct branch_entry entry; - int out = 0, i; + int out = 0, idx, i; if (!cpuc->lbr_users) return; @@ -160,8 +167,11 @@ void amd_pmu_lbr_read(void) entry.from.full = amd_pmu_lbr_get_from(i); entry.to.full = amd_pmu_lbr_get_to(i); - /* Check if a branch has been logged */ - if (!entry.to.split.valid) + /* + * Check if a branch has been logged; if valid = 0, spec = 0 + * then no branch was recorded + */ + if (!entry.to.split.valid && !entry.to.split.spec) continue; perf_clear_branch_entry_bitfields(br + out); @@ -170,6 +180,25 @@ void amd_pmu_lbr_read(void) br[out].to = sign_ext_branch_ip(entry.to.split.ip); br[out].mispred = entry.from.split.mispredict; br[out].predicted = !br[out].mispred; + + /* + * Set branch speculation information using the status of + * the valid and spec bits. + * + * When valid = 0, spec = 0, no branch was recorded and the + * entry is discarded as seen above. + * + * When valid = 0, spec = 1, the recorded branch was + * speculative but took the wrong path. + * + * When valid = 1, spec = 0, the recorded branch was + * non-speculative but took the correct path. + * + * When valid = 1, spec = 1, the recorded branch was + * speculative and took the correct path + */ + idx = (entry.to.split.valid << 1) | entry.to.split.spec; + br[out].spec = lbr_spec_map[idx]; out++; } -- 2.34.1
